The Health Sciences Learning Center (HSLC) at the University of Wisconsin-Madison is the site of classroom instruction and clinical skills training for the University of Wisconsin School of Medicine and Public Health and UW School of Nursing. It also houses the Ebling Library as well as academic and administrative offices.
